United state News reports that orthodontists gained a median income of $208,000 in 2018. Lower-paid orthodontists make around $142,470. Research study from the Bureau of Labor Stats (BLS) located that in 2019, the typical wage had reached $230,830.




Zipcrecruiter has actually put together a table of typical orthodontist salaries by state to contrast salaries in your area. Orthodontists are accredited dental experts who concentrate on the art of appropriately aligning teeth for far better oral wellness, better overall health and wellness, more efficient and comfortable bite, and higher smile confidence. Each patients' instance is unique, so orthodontists have to have a wide understanding and experience in a wide array of treatment strategies and home appliances.


In enhancement to collaborating with patients, orthodontists are typically in charge of leading a group of oral experts, which needs directing and supervising dental aides and hygienists, and working with workplace managers to keep the office running efficiently. Those orthodontists that enter into personal method will certainly also be responsible for the lots of aspects of local business ownership, consisting of paying taxes and office rental charges, tracking budgets, working with, monitoring, and discipling staff, and a lot more.


That's because all orthodontists are, actually, dentists: they complete dental institution and becoming licensed dentists prior to taking place to specialize via a residency program. Oral institution is generally 4 years: candidates must have completed undergraduate education and take the Oral Analysis Test (DAT). The examination is racked up on a range from 1-30, with the ordinary score being 17.

Due to the fact that straight teeth and wellness smiles area always popular, orthodontists enjoy sunny job expectations for the direct future. According to U.S. Information, The Bureau of Labor Data, which tracks task development and jobs numbers for the future, expects orthodontic jobs to grow by 7.3% between 2018 and 2028, with an estimated 500 brand-new work opening.

Orthodontist frequently work full time, however there are choices for part-time work, including for semi-retired orthodontists. Every office schedules differently: some larger practices are open 7 days a week, with a rotating team of orthodontists and aides that take turns functioning weekend breaks. Others are only open Monday through Friday, or for certain hours on certain days.

There are a selection of specialist alternatives for orthodontists: As a participant of an orthodontic group, you will certainly have your own caseload of individuals yet work under a managing orthodontist or clinical director.


Many orthodontists begin as component of a group method, but go on to begin their own company or companion with 1 or 2 other orthodontists. This makes them both exercising orthodontists and local business owners, using a tiny group of dental assistants, hygienists, and/or office managers to aid them see and handle people.


Practice ownership likewise calls for supervising stringent conformity with state and federal guidelines for person and staff health and wellness and safety and click security, clinical personal privacy, labor methods, and much more. Most of practitioners handle debt in order to open up a workplace, so there are huge economic threats involved. Starting your very own orthodontic technique is financially high-risk and a demanding life path, but an effective personal technique can create a lot greater wages and work versatility, especially if your method broadens by employing even more orthodontists.
